Tiverton Officers to hand out gift cards for good driving

Published

on

If you are stopped today by a Tiverton Police Officer, don’t panic just yet. You may be getting a reward. Tiverton Police are giving an added incentive for drivers on this fourth of July.

According to the Tiverton Police Department, extra officers have been added today to ensure a safe and happy Independence Day for residents. Officers will not only be vigilant for “bad” driving behavior but in honor of our country’s independence, officers will be looking for examples of good driving habits and will reward motorists with gift cards courtesy of Dunkin’ Donuts and Sakonnet River Grille. TPD have gift cards for $5, $10, and one gift card for $17.76. Officers will be handing these cards out to citizens with quotes from the founders in honor of our country’s birth and continued freedom and liberty. Happy Independence Day courtesy of Tiverton Police!
